117 A small stream rising on the northern side of the Ochill Hills It joins the Allan Water after a course of about a mile & a half in a northern direction,

117 A small stream rising on the Ochill Hills. It joins Kinpauch Burn at the east end of Blackford Village, after a short course in a northern direction,

117 An oak tree situated on a hillock adjoining Blackford Village, It was planted on the 10th March 1863 to commemorate the marriage of His Royal Highness the Princes of Wales,
